Skip to content

Instantly share code, notes, and snippets.

@r-rmcgibbo
Created March 6, 2021 16:42
Show Gist options
  • Save r-rmcgibbo/8ecb5076ac1e8b1c2bee690f8949a300 to your computer and use it in GitHub Desktop.
Save r-rmcgibbo/8ecb5076ac1e8b1c2bee690f8949a300 to your computer and use it in GitHub Desktop.
system: aarch64-linux | build_time: 26 seconds | https://github.com/NixOS/nixpkgs/pull/115268
@nix { "action": "setPhase", "phase": "unpackPhase" }
unpacking sources
unpacking source archive /nix/store/345c1rgnsvfzb6gjkqpdhp856bsz7xfq-source
source root is source
Executing cargoSetupPostUnpackHook
unpacking source archive /nix/store/ar7i47q012xfqxrv5wsax3glyl5gkrb9-shadowsocks-rust-1.9.2-vendor.tar.gz
Finished cargoSetupPostUnpackHook
@nix { "action": "setPhase", "phase": "patchPhase" }
patching sources
Executing cargoSetupPostPatchHook
Validating consistency between /build/source//Cargo.lock and /build/shadowsocks-rust-1.9.2-vendor.tar.gz/Cargo.lock
Finished cargoSetupPostPatchHook
@nix { "action": "setPhase", "phase": "updateAutotoolsGnuConfigScriptsPhase" }
updateAutotoolsGnuConfigScriptsPhase
@nix { "action": "setPhase", "phase": "configurePhase" }
configuring
@nix { "action": "setPhase", "phase": "buildPhase" }
building
Executing cargoBuildHook
++ env CC_aarch64-unknown-linux-gnu=/nix/store/qpm5i2647q95clkr96f47q5j57ng7h62-gcc-wrapper-9.3.0/bin/cc CXX_aarch64-unknown-linux-gnu=/nix/store/qpm5i2647q95clkr96f47q5j57ng7h62-gcc-wrapper-9.3.0/bin/c++ CC_aarch64-unknown-linux-gnu=/nix/store/qpm5i2647q95clkr96f47q5j57ng7h62-gcc-wrapper-9.3.0/bin/cc CXX_aarch64-unknown-linux-gnu=/nix/store/qpm5i2647q95clkr96f47q5j57ng7h62-gcc-wrapper-9.3.0/bin/c++ cargo build -j 2 --target aarch64-unknown-linux-gnu --frozen --release
Compiling proc-macro2 v1.0.24
Compiling unicode-xid v0.2.1
Compiling libc v0.2.87
Compiling syn v1.0.61
Compiling cfg-if v1.0.0
Compiling autocfg v1.0.1
Compiling serde_derive v1.0.123
Compiling serde v1.0.123
Compiling memchr v2.3.4
Compiling log v0.4.14
Compiling once_cell v1.7.2
Compiling pin-project-lite v0.2.6
Compiling proc-macro-hack v0.5.19
Compiling lazy_static v1.4.0
Compiling futures-core v0.3.13
Compiling smallvec v1.6.1
Compiling proc-macro-nested v0.1.7
Compiling scopeguard v1.1.0
Compiling futures-sink v0.3.13
Compiling getrandom v0.2.2
Compiling bytes v1.0.1
Compiling itoa v0.4.7
Compiling futures-io v0.3.13
Compiling futures-task v0.3.13
Compiling pin-utils v0.1.0
Compiling slab v0.4.2
Compiling matches v0.1.8
Compiling bitflags v1.2.1
Compiling tinyvec_macros v0.1.0
Compiling ppv-lite86 v0.2.10
Compiling ryu v1.0.5
Compiling linked-hash-map v0.5.4
Compiling percent-encoding v2.1.0
Compiling async-trait v0.1.45
Compiling unicode-segmentation v1.7.1
Compiling fnv v1.0.7
Compiling ucd-trie v0.1.3
Compiling cc v1.0.67
Compiling match_cfg v0.1.0
Compiling serde_json v1.0.64
Compiling maplit v1.0.2
Compiling ipnet v2.3.0
Compiling traitobject v0.1.0
Compiling same-file v1.0.6
Compiling anyhow v1.0.38
Compiling httparse v1.3.5
Compiling data-encoding v2.3.2
Compiling quick-error v1.2.3
Compiling spin v0.5.2
Compiling hashbrown v0.9.1
Compiling untrusted v0.7.1
Compiling tower-service v0.3.1
Compiling siphasher v0.3.3
Compiling try-lock v0.2.3
Compiling crypto2 v0.1.1
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/ghash/./aarch64.rs:18:25
|
18 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/ghash/./aarch64.rs:18:28
|
18 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/ghash/./aarch64.rs:26:25
|
26 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/ghash/./aarch64.rs:26:28
|
26 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:14:33
|
14 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:14:36
|
14 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:19:33
|
19 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:19:36
|
19 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:24:33
|
24 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:24:36
|
24 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:29:33
|
29 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
error[E0308]: mismatched types
--> /build/shadowsocks-rust-1.9.2-vendor.tar.gz/crypto2/src/mac/polyval/./aarch64.rs:29:36
|
29 | transmute(vmull_p64(a, b))
| ^ expected struct `poly64_t`, found `u64`
Compiling regex-syntax v0.6.22
error: aborting due to 12 previous errors
For more information about this error, try `rustc --explain E0308`.
error: could not compile `crypto2`
To learn more, run the command again with --verbose.
warning: build failed, waiting for other jobs to finish...
error: build failed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ment